Check out Origin London’s new collection.“Founded by 17-year old Gabriel Noble, Origin London is an independent clothing company that will release four limited edition t-shirts with UK art collectives TIMC (This Is My Costume) and Puck during summer 2011.”

One thing I’ve noticed is that 3/4 T-shirts have animal references. Now was this a concious choice or was it just meaningless sh*t a middle class cool kid cooked up in his bedroom.On face value the rat,the pigeon and the pig are all symbols of filth,dirt and disease however, if you look deeper you realise that all these animals live is harsh environments and must do what they can to survive.
My guess is that Gaberial has put a spot light on these animals to illustrate gritty side of London. Cheesy as this may sound I believe that this collection says “be proud of who you are” we’re all products of our environment and must do what we can to survive.
